Submerged Electric
#314


The Submerged Electric Company of Menomonie, Wisconsin was the first outboard company to produce motors in serious numbers. This particular motor was one of the later examples. The earlier version had a different skeg which wasn't nearly as nice as this shape.

Loretta and Arlan Carter are using this motor in the photos on the Submerged Electric home page.
Arlan is the author of The American Rowboat Moto and this motor is on page 24.
